Description
- Description:
 - Removes given objects from the unit's list of synchronized objects.
 - Groups:
 - Object Manipulation
 
Syntax
- Syntax:
 - unit synchronizeObjectsRemove objects
 - Parameters:
 - unit: Object
 - objects: Array - An array of objects
 - Return Value:
 - Nothing
 
Examples
- Example 1:
 player synchronizeObjectsRemove [_object1, _object2, _object3]
Additional Information
- See also:
 - synchronizeObjectsAdd
